David Miculescu operates as a Bronze-tier Sniper for FCSB. The 25-year-old forward has been with the club since his 2022 move from UTA Arad, looking to build his body of work in the Romanian top flight. Still hunting for his first major career silverware, our verdict is that he needs far more consistent involvement to match his raw attacking potential.
His data paints a picture of a forward searching for rhythm. While he profiles as a natural finisher with a strong Shooting dimension, he has largely struggled to stamp his authority on matches. Across nine appearances and 484 minutes this term, he has too often drifted out of games, earning the GHOST badge for his frustratingly low touch counts. However, when he does get on the ball, he retains it exceptionally well, operating as a METRONOME with highly accurate link-up play. Despite this neat passing, zero goals and assists in his last five outings confirm he is going through a quiet spell in the final third.
With his market valuation holding steady at €2M, the stakes are clear for the attacker. To justify his price tag and move past emerging status, he must translate his tidy possession into genuine penalty-box threat.
